Losing voice can be a symptom of laryngitis or sometimes Croup. This can be dangerous for the child as it can compromise airway. You need to get your child examined by the Paediatrician to prevent complications. Hydrate the child well, carefully. Don't give anything cold by mouth. Only warm food or fluids. Continue breast feeding.
